#VU100116 Prototype pollution in dset - CVE-2024-21529

Description

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ary JavaScript code.

The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ation. A remote attacker can pass specially crafted input to the application and perform prototype pollution, which can result in information disclosure or data manipulation.


Remediation

Install update from vendor's website.
